2012-01-26 20 views
0

私はデータを表示するフォームを持っています。ユーザーが「編集」をクリックしてフィールドが編集可能になり、フォームを保存すると、フォームがHTMLフォームとしても動作します。実装への任意のポインタ?htmlフォームを表示/編集する

+1

http://www.appelsiini.net/projects/jeditable/custom.htmlを試してみてください –

答えて

1

この

$(document).ready({ 
    var span_field = ".spn_data" 
    var btn_edit = "#btnedit" 
    var btn_save = "#btnsave" 

    $(btn_edit).click(function(){ 
     $(span_field).each(function(){ 
      $(this).replaceWith("<input type='text' value='" + $(this).html() + "' class='spn_data' />"); 
     }); 
    }); 

    $(btn_save).click(function(){ 
     $(span_field).each(function(){ 
      $(this).replaceWith("<span class='spn_data'>" + $(this).val() + "'</span>"); 
     }); 
     // do save 
    }); 


}); 
2

私は、フォームの要素を無効にして、標準のスタイリングを上書きして、通常のように見えると思うと思います。

関連する問題